There is a pressing need for a balanced account outlining what DeFi actually means for investors, banks and the finance industry.
Why DeFi Matters
cuts through the jargon and the hype to help people make more informed decisions in this space. It examines the evolution of DeFi and cryptocurrencies, analysing what it means for investors and the future of finance. It also outlines the developments that truly matter, distinguishing between longer-term trends and fads, and is a must-read for finance professionals, organizations and investors interested in moving into DeFi.
explores the rise of DeFi and provides focused, balanced analysis about this alternative financial system that is being built and how it will coexist with banks, institutions and traditional finance. It examines the aspects of DeFi that will materially change financial systems and how they will alter the nature of purchasing, lending, insurance and banking; the role of web3 and the metaverse in the new era of finance; and its role in the democratization of finance.

Barnes & Noble does business -- big business -- by the book. As the #1 bookseller in the US, it operates about 720 Barnes & Noble superstores (selling books, music, movies, and gifts) throughout all 50 US states and Washington, DC. The stores are typically 10,000 to 60,000 sq. ft. and stock between 60,000 and 200,000 book titles. Many of its locations contain Starbucks cafes, as well as music departments that carry more than 30,000 titles.
